The extra-large Tundra 45 Hard Cooler has a wide lid that shows off the icy blue camo pattern, but it’s not too over-the-top — the sides of the lid are powdery blue, and the cooler's body is a neutral, complementary gray. This Yeti cooler can hold up to 54 cans or 37 pounds of ice, so it's perfect for short camping trips or tailgating. Roadie 15 Hard Cooler Yeti $200 at Yeti This is the compact version of the editor-loved Yeti Roadie 48 Hard Cooler. It currently comes in 13 seasonal colors as part of the Gear Garage drop, including returning colors like key lime, a minty green shade, and aquifer blue, a stunning turquoise. This is the perfect small, on-the-go Yeti cooler; it fits 22 cans or 16 pounds of ice and isn’t too cumbersome to carry. Rambler 12-Ounce Colster Can Cooler Yeti $25 at Yeti An insulated beer koozie is a must year-round; it keeps your beverage from warming up in hot weather and keeps your hands from getting cold in cool weather. We named this one the best overall koozie in testing because it kept our drinks cold for more than two hours.
